
Taking cues from horror classics, this tattoo recreates the iconic Scream mask on a forearm or leg, cracked and dripping with crimson ink. The blurred edges and smoky tendrils give it a haunting, almost animated feel—face morphing from plaster to gore. Its style merges realism with surreal motion, making the mask seem like it’s peeling between worlds—caught between death and dream.
